What We Deliver
Program & Project Management
Full-lifecycle delivery ownership from initiation through close-out. We build and manage detailed project plans, track milestones, control scope, and maintain stakeholder alignment — ensuring your initiative moves forward with precision and full executive visibility at every phase.
Agile & Waterfall Delivery
Experienced across Scrum, SAFe, and traditional waterfall methodologies — and skilled at designing hybrid models where regulated deliverables demand audit trails alongside rapid iterative development. We match the methodology to your team, not the other way around.
Cross-Functional Team Leadership
Align engineering, product, QA, security, DevOps, and business stakeholders around shared delivery goals. We establish clear RACI structures, communication cadences, and escalation paths that eliminate ambiguity and keep distributed teams executing in concert — regardless of geography or time zone.
Risk & Issue Management
Identify, quantify, and mitigate risks before they become project-threatening incidents. We maintain living risk registers, escalate blocking issues with clear resolution paths, and provide leadership with accurate, unvarnished status — not the sanitized version.
Regulatory-Compliant Delivery
Deliver technology projects inside regulated environments — FDA 21 CFR Part 11, GxP, HIPAA, and SOC 2 — without sacrificing velocity. We integrate validation protocols, electronic audit trails, and change control procedures directly into the delivery process, not as an afterthought at the end.
Vendor & Stakeholder Management
Manage third-party technology vendors, system integrators, and offshore development partners with contractual precision. We hold vendors accountable to SLAs, manage change orders, and ensure executive stakeholders receive clear, timely communication without project managers filtering out the difficult truths.
Our Delivery Approach
Every project engagement follows a structured, three-phase model designed to establish clarity before execution, maintain control during delivery, and transfer knowledge cleanly at close-out.
Discovery & Planning
Rapid assessment of current state, stakeholder goals, technical constraints, and regulatory requirements. We produce a detailed project charter, delivery roadmap, and resource plan before a single line of code is written.
Execution & Governance
Active day-to-day delivery leadership with weekly executive status, bi-weekly steering committee reviews, and a continuous risk register. Decisions are made at the right level, with the right information, at the right time.
Delivery & Transition
Structured close-out with documented lessons learned, runbook handoffs, and a 30-day post-launch stabilization window. Your team inherits a system they can own and operate — not a dependency on the consulting firm.
